Output 5bc4ca7e58f269ef74366caaf83b5fb1e5600a916e1062c57b0d9d3086e704f3:12

value
2931404186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090578e259ecb0a2b126e93a9d2c5e2fefae4554 OP_EQUAL
address
32WiZV7sFg6w2CPuojiHbvXuDsAXtrvhNF
transaction
5bc4ca7e58f269ef74366caaf83b5fb1e5600a916e1062c57b0d9d3086e704f3
confirmations
306046
spent
true